About JEMS

JEMS is a 44-metre displacement motor yacht built by Heesen in 2009 to the 4400 model specification, registered in the Cayman Islands. Her exterior was designed by Heesen in collaboration with Omega Architects, combining the Dutch yard's structural discipline with Omega's characteristic attention to profile and visual proportion — an approach that has produced a vessel with enduring presence.

She accommodates 10 guests in 5 cabins attended by 9 crew, a ratio that positions JEMS toward the upper end of attentive service for a yacht of her class. Her charter territory spans the Western Mediterranean: the Amalfi Coast, French Riviera, Sardinia, Corsica, Monaco, and associated Italian and French coastal regions. She is well suited to discerning groups of up to 10 who value build quality and seamanship over volume or novelty; guests seeking Caribbean operations or larger group capacity will need to look elsewhere.

Built on an aluminium displacement hull, JEMS displaces 458 gross tonnes and achieves a cruising speed of 16 knots with a maximum of 25 knots — a performance envelope that is notably capable for a displacement vessel of her length. The range of 1,152 nautical miles is appropriate for Mediterranean operations. Heesen's aluminium construction is associated with structural precision, reduced overall weight versus steel equivalents, and a lively sea-keeping character that many guests find preferable on longer passages.

The onboard experience is complemented by a deck jacuzzi and gym, with at-anchor stabilisers contributing to comfort when moored. Water sports include a banana towable, wake board, water ski, doughnut, jet ski, and snorkelling equipment, providing scope for active days at anchor. About This Score

This is a provisional score based on publicly available data only. Unlike verified yachts, this listing lacks:

  • Independent on-board inspection
  • Crew qualification verification
  • Maintenance record audit
  • Safety equipment inspection

The actual safety profile may differ significantly.

Provisional scores are calculated from eight factors: vessel age, refit recency, classification society, flag state, crew-to-guest ratio, builder reputation, vessel size, and charter region coverage. All provisional scores are capped at 75/100. Learn how scores work →
